What Is The Best Way To Invest In Gold

by Barbara Miller

Investing in gold has long been a popular choice for investors seeking to diversify their portfolios and hedge against economic uncertainties. However, with various investment options available, determining the best way to invest in gold can be daunting. This article aims to provide a comprehensive guide to the different methods of investing in gold, highlighting their advantages, disadvantages, and suitability for different investors.

Understanding the Best Ways to Invest in Gold:

Physical Gold:

Bullion: Purchasing physical gold bullion, such as bars and coins, allows investors to own tangible assets with intrinsic value.

Advantages: Bullion offers direct exposure to the price of gold and can serve as a hedge against inflation and currency devaluation.

Disadvantages: Storing and insuring physical gold can incur additional costs, and liquidity may be limited compared to other investment options.

Gold ETFs (Exchange-Traded Funds):

Definition: Gold ETFs are investment funds that track the price of gold and trade on stock exchanges like individual stocks.

Advantages: Gold ETFs provide investors with exposure to gold without the need for physical ownership. They offer liquidity, ease of trading, and typically have lower costs compared to owning physical gold.

Disadvantages: Investors do not directly own the underlying gold in Gold ETFs, and there may be tracking errors or counterparty risks associated with these investments.

Gold Mining Stocks:

Investing in gold mining companies involves purchasing shares of companies engaged in gold exploration, production, or mining operations.

Advantages: Gold mining stocks can offer leverage to the price of gold, as the profitability of mining companies often increases with rising gold prices.

Disadvantages: Investing in individual mining stocks carries company-specific risks such as operational issues, management decisions, and geopolitical factors that may affect the company’s performance independent of gold prices.

Gold Futures and Options:

Definition: Gold futures and options contracts allow investors to speculate on the future price of gold without owning the physical asset.

Advantages: Futures and options offer leverage and flexibility for traders looking to profit from short-term price movements in the gold market.

Disadvantages: These derivatives carry higher risks and require a deep understanding of market dynamics, as losses can exceed the initial investment, especially in volatile markets.

Gold Mutual Funds:

Definition: Gold mutual funds invest in a diversified portfolio of gold-related assets, including physical gold, mining stocks, and derivatives.

Advantages: Mutual funds offer diversification and professional management, making them suitable for investors seeking exposure to gold without the need for active management.

Disadvantages: Like other actively managed funds, gold mutual funds may charge higher fees, and performance can vary based on fund manager decisions and market conditions.

Choosing the Best Gold Investment Strategy:

Risk Tolerance: Investors should assess their risk tolerance and investment objectives when selecting a gold investment strategy. Those with a higher risk tolerance may opt for more speculative investments like gold futures, while conservative investors may prefer physical gold or Gold ETFs for stability.

Time Horizon: Consider the investment time horizon, as different gold investment vehicles may be more suitable for short-term trading or long-term wealth preservation.

Diversification: Incorporating gold investments into a diversified portfolio can help mitigate overall risk and improve risk-adjusted returns.

Costs and Fees: Evaluate the costs associated with each investment option, including transaction fees, management fees, and storage costs, to ensure they align with your investment goals.
